Abstract: This paper develops a reduced IPv6 Stack based on FPGA,and analyzes the function of each module.The Verilog HDL model of the architecture is coded,simulated and synthesized.Then the design is verified by ALTERA FPGA.The results of the simulation and experiments indicate that the hardware implementation meets the design requirement,and it is more efficient for the small devices to connect to Internet.
